The Importance of CPD Accreditation in Finance
Continuing Professional Development (CPD) accreditation is a critical factor in professional education and career growth. In the financial industry, where regulations, products, and market conditions change frequently, CPD ensures professionals remain current, compliant, and competitive.
TheCPD accreditation of the Investment Advisor Certification signifies:
- Industry recognition – Respected by employers, financial institutions, and regulatory bodies.
- Regulatory alignment – Helps professionals meet compliance requirements in investment advisory.
- Continuous learning – Ensures that advisors remain up to date with market developments and best practices.
- Career progression – Enhances job opportunities, positioning professionals for leadership roles in finance.
Holding a CPD-accredited certification is a key differentiator for investment professionals looking to excel in a regulated and evolving industry.
